You can customize a weather widget in several ways. Firstly, you must define the location of the widget. There are different options to set the location, including metric and imperial units. In addition, you can also specify the number of days the weather forecast should cover.
Once you’ve created a widget, you can embed it in your website. You can do this by copying the installation code and pasting it into your HTML code. The widget will then show up where you pasted it. The widget is also fully customizable and can adapt to its container size. It will fit in the main content area of your website or a sidebar, and it can also be configured for mobile devices. Google Tag Manager allows you to add widgets through custom HTML
If you want to add widgets to your website, you can use Google Tag Manager. This free service allows you to add widgets to your site and manage your code in one place. To use GTM, you need to configure the service. The only difference between a regular widget and a widget managed through GTM is the type of widget. A widget managed through GTM can be a floating one.
In contrast, a custom HTML tag can wreak havoc on your performance. For example, your single-page app may not reset the DOM between transitions, which can lead to performance degradation. This can lead to a large hit on the user experience.
